Consequence for Wavefunction Collapse Model of the Sudbury Neutrino Observatory Experiment
Abstract
It is shown that data on the dissociation rate of deuterium obtained in an experiment at the Sudbury Neutrino Observatory provides evidence that the Continuous Spontaneous Localization wavefunction collapse model should have mass--proportional coupling to be viable.
